Concrete Issues & Repair Insights in Troy

Glacial till and silty clay dominate the subgrade in much of the region, and both hold water long enough to undermine support beneath slabs. Sidewalk trip hazards show up after winter, when frost heave pushes one panel higher than its neighbor. Garage floors, driveways, and front walks are the three surfaces homeowners ask about most, often in that order. Traditional mudjacking handles heavy settlement well, but lighter foam injection is often recommended where added weight on wet soil could cause further sinking.

When concrete moves in Troy, the important question is not just where it cracked, but where the subgrade lost support and why.

Local subgrade commonly mixes compacted fill, silt loam, and fractured shale from utility cuts and older site work. That blend drains unevenly, so one corner of a slab can stay saturated while adjacent sections dry out. Differential moisture means differential movement, which is the core driver behind recurring settlement lips.

Seasonality is a major factor in Troy: wet spring periods, summer storm bursts, and cold winter swings all act on slab support differently. Frozen ground can heave sections during cold snaps, while thaw periods leave saturated pockets that settle under normal loading. The same joints often reopen year after year for this reason.

Local crews frequently level settlement at garage aprons, pool deck corners, and municipal-adjacent sidewalks where elevation mismatches create liability concerns. In business districts around Troy, storefront entries and parking-lot walk connections are also common repair targets.

Homeowners in Troy can expect small lift-and-stabilize repairs to start around $700 to $1,100, then scale with panel count and void depth. Foam methods usually range from $8 to $20 per square foot, and mudjacking from $4 to $10. Broad driveway plus walkway scopes often close between $2,200 and $5,800.

The strongest proposals explain why the slab moved, how lift will be staged, and what moisture controls are needed so the repair lasts.

What Is Garage Floor Leveling?

How garage floor leveling works for Troy homeowners.

Garage floor leveling corrects settled garage slabs that have sunk due to soil issues or poor compaction. Restoring a level garage floor prevents water pooling, protects vehicles, and improves usability. The technique works on driveways, sidewalks, patios, garage floors, and pool decks.

How Much Does Garage Floor Leveling Cost in Troy?

What to expect when budgeting for garage floor leveling in Troy, PA.

Garage Floor Leveling in Troy typically costs $3 to $10 per square foot, or $500 to $3,000 for a typical residential project. The exact price depends on the slab size, the amount of settlement, and how easy it is to access the area.

Garage Floor Leveling estimate range in Troy: roughly $3 to $10 per sq ft, or about $500 to $3,000 for many residential jobs.

These are general estimates, not fixed quotes for Troy. Final pricing depends on slab size, settlement depth, access, and method selection.

Pool deck repairs in Troy tend to cost $1,000 to $3,000 due to the larger surface area. A settled walkway section is more affordable, typically $200 to $600.

Polyurethane foam injection tends to cost a bit more than traditional mudjacking, but it cures faster and puts less weight on the soil underneath. Ask each Troy contractor whether their quote includes addressing the underlying soil issue, not just lifting the slab.

What to Look for in a Garage Floor Leveling Contractor

On-Site Estimates

A reliable garage floor leveling contractor will visit your Troy property before giving you a price. Phone or email quotes are less accurate because they can't account for soil conditions, slab access, or the extent of settlement.

Written Contracts

Before any work begins, get a written contract that spells out the scope, materials, timeline, price, and warranty terms. Verbal agreements leave too much room for misunderstanding.

Approach to Soil Issues

Ask each contractor how they plan to address the root cause of the settlement, not just lift the slab. The best garage floor leveling providers in Troy will explain what caused the sinking and what steps they take to prevent it from recurring.

Timeline and Access

Find out how long the repair will take and when you can use the slab again. Most jobs take a few hours, but cure times differ between mudjacking (24-48 hours) and foam injection (15-30 minutes).
